19th Century Japanese Scroll Painting by Igarashi Chikusa, Poppies & Butterflies
Located in Kyoto, JP
Poppies & Butterflies
Ink, pigment and gofun on silk
Igarashi Chikusa (1774-1844)
Signature: Chikusa Ran Zen
Upper Seal: Ran Shuzen
Lower Seal: Kyoho
Dimensions:
Scroll: H. 68” x W. 18” (172cm x 45cm)
Image: H. 38.5’’ x W. 12.5’’ (98cm x 32cm)
This composition shows elegant images of poppies and the butterflies that are inevitably drawn to them. It captures a momentary glimpse into a world both visually dazzling and startlingly realistic. The painting is infused with sensitivity and attention to seasonal change and weather conditions. The thin and fragile poppies are beautifully depicted with brilliant colors and the butterflies are similarly infused with life. The painting is on silk which requires extremely precise painting skills as no element once painted can be removed.
Poppies were a favorite subject of Rinpa school artists through the ages. Originally they were somewhat abstracted but by the age of Sakai Hoitsu...
